TikTok

  • Released in September of 2016, TikTok is a social media platform that lets users create a variety of short videos with a wide variety of genres, ranging from comedy and dance, to education and promotions.

  • One of the reasons why TikTok has become one of the biggest media platforms is due to the constant entertainment of these short videos. The videos are curated towards the users’ likes retention rate, but this doesn’t mean the user can always know what to expect. Because of the easy-to-use features, micro-entertainment, and its predecessors — Musically & Vine — TikTok is now one of the most popular social platforms among Generation Z.

Tick-Tock, It’s Time to Get Creative!

  1. Create your own channel & upload videos advertising your product.

    • Making a TikTok is the first step in providing your customers with insight into your business and showing them what you’re all about. People love to watch transformational videos, so some TikTok ideas could be: “How I Package Orders!” or “Watch Me Create [insert product]!”

    • If you can find a way to encourage your customers to share videos of themselves using or interacting with your products in some way, you’re likely to get a more successful response.

  2. Keep in touch with what is trending & try to tie that into your TikToks.

    • Although this is not a necessity, using trends that are popular will increase engagement. This can be something as simple as using the same song that is trending in your videos (for instance, Olivia Rodrigo’s Drivers License).

  3. Hashtags. Hashtags. Hashtags. Did I mention hashtags?

    • Hashtags help categorize the video to cater to different audiences. So if your business was a clothing store centered in San Francisco, you should use “#clothing #SanFrancisco #style #fyp” and so forth. This is also not required for your video to gain attention but it definitely helps more than not putting anything!

Instagram

  • Happy Belated 10th Birthday to Instagram! Launched in October 2010, Instagram has now accumulated over one billion users. This app is used to stay updated with the lives of our friends, families, and favorite celebrities. With a heavy emphasis on photo and video sharing, Instagram has evolved throughout the years and has become a huge brand marketing platform. New updates have been added such as stories, highlight reels, and a shopping tab which all help users to be exposed to different accounts and businesses.

  • Often referred to as the “simplified version of Facebook”, Instagram is a social network that lets you see how many followers you have, how many you are following, how many likes you have on each photo, and so forth. It is an app that is big on numbers and creating the perfect image for our followers to see.

Pics or It Didn’t Happen

  1. Personal to Business Account

    • Instagram has a feature that lets you change the type of account you have. The perks of turning your account into a business account, are that you can access the data analytics of your posts, separate your messaging inboxes and display your contact information on your profile.

  2. Aesthetic Content

    • Since Instagram focuses on photos and videos, it’s important to generate visually compelling content that entails what your brand is and shows your products. To keep your audience engaged, try to include a variety of content, whether that be quotes or instructional posts.

  3. Use Story Highlights

    • Story Highlights are placed at the bottom of your Instagram bio and are immediately seen when a user visits your profile. Knowing this, it’s important to create different categories that you would want potential consumers to visit to learn more information quicker. For example, if you’re a photography company, different highlight categories could be “Prices,” “Published Work,” “Behind the Scenes,” and so on.

Facebook

  • What started as a website intended for Harvard students to communicate has become the most popular social media platform worldwide today. Originally launched as “TheFacebook” in 2004, the platform currently sits at more than 2.7 billion monthly active users. This social networking site makes it easy for users to connect and share with friends and family online.

  • Over the years, the platform has integrated businesses by including ads, promotions, and entertainment. It has become easy to sell your product and enhance your own business on Facebook as it is easier to use than other platforms and has been around for longer. Although the younger generations would undoubtedly say that Facebook is used for older generations, it still plays an influential role in the social networking world.

*Gently Pokes You*

  1. Create a Facebook Business Page

    • Similar to Instagram’s business features, Facebook has an option to create your own business page that will allow you to add a “call-to-action” button, create your own username, see who views your page, and so on.

  2. Keep Them Engaged

    • Facebook is about building relationships so don’t focus too much on self-promotion when you should be building value for your followers. For example, creating instructional videos, polling your followers, answering questions and taking into account the concerns of your followers, will help you build a more stable relationship with your followers and extend your reach.

  3. Link Your Website

    • With so many Internet users that are only increasing, it’s easy to run into website traffic. By creating your own website and including an option to stay connected through Facebook, users can easily become customers and switch back and forth between your Facebook Page and your website for more info.
